By Product Type
Boom Lifts:
Boom lifts are one of the most versatile types of aerial platform vehicles available in the market. They are characterized by a telescoping arm that can extend vertically and horizontally, allowing operators to reach elevated work areas with ease. This type of aerial platform is particularly popular in industries such as construction and maintenance, where workers need to access hard-to-reach places securely. The increasing adoption of boom lifts is attributed to their ability to provide a stable platform for workers while offering flexibility in movement. Furthermore, advancements in boom lift technologies, such as improved engine efficiency and enhanced safety features, are driving their demand in the market. As construction activities surge around the globe, boom lifts are expected to witness consistent growth in usage across various applications.
Scissor Lifts:
Scissor lifts are another prominent type of aerial platform vehicle, known for their vertical lifting capabilities. Their design allows for the platform to extend upwards in a straight line, which makes them ideal for tasks that require significant height without lateral movement. Scissor lifts are widely utilized in industrial environments, warehouses, and construction sites where stable, elevated work platforms are needed. The growing preference for scissor lifts is due to their ease of use, compact design, and ability to navigate through narrow spaces. Furthermore, the introduction of electric-powered scissor lifts aligns with environmental concerns and regulations, making them a favorable choice among companies looking to reduce their carbon footprint.
Vertical Mast Lifts:
Vertical mast lifts are compact aerial platforms designed for maneuverability in tight spaces. They are equipped with a vertical mast that can extend upwards, allowing operators to reach heights of approximately 20-30 feet. These lifts are particularly beneficial in indoor environments, such as warehouses and retail spaces, where space is limited. As more businesses focus on optimizing their operational efficiency and safety protocols, vertical mast lifts are becoming increasingly popular. Innovations in battery technology have also made electric vertical mast lifts more efficient, further driving their adoption in various sectors. Their lightweight design and ease of transport make them a preferred choice for short-term projects and maintenance tasks.
Telescopic Boom Lifts:
Telescopic boom lifts are designed for reaching high, difficult-to-access locations with precision. These lifts feature a boom that can extend outwards and upwards, providing significant horizontal reach in addition to vertical height. The advantage of telescopic boom lifts is their ability to navigate around obstacles, making them ideal for construction and maintenance tasks in complex environments. The demand for telescopic boom lifts is expected to rise as industries require equipment that can operate in increasingly challenging spaces. Furthermore, advancements in control systems and safety features are enhancing the usability of telescopic boom lifts, ensuring that they remain a critical component in the aerial platform vehicle market.
Articulating Boom Lifts:
Articulating boom lifts, often referred to as knuckle booms, are designed with joints that allow the boom to bend, providing exceptional flexibility and reach. They are ideal for tasks that require access over obstacles or into tight spaces, making them a favorite in both construction and maintenance projects. The unique design allows operators to maneuver around obstacles while providing a stable work platform. Articulating boom lifts have become increasingly popular due to their versatility and ability to operate in various terrains and environments. As urban infrastructure projects grow and require access to challenging areas, the demand for articulating boom lifts is expected to increase significantly.
By Application
Construction:
The construction industry is one of the largest segments driving the demand for aerial platform vehicles. These vehicles are crucial for facilitating a wide range of construction tasks, including framing, roofing, and installing structures at height. Aerial platforms provide workers with safe and efficient access to elevated areas, improving productivity and enhancing safety protocols on job sites. As urbanization and infrastructure projects grow worldwide, the construction sector's reliance on aerial platform vehicles will continue to expand. Additionally, the push for more sustainable building practices is leading to the adoption of electric and hybrid-powered aerial platforms, further supporting market growth.
Industrial:
The industrial application segment for aerial platform vehicles encompasses manufacturing and warehousing operations where high-reaching tasks are necessary. Aerial platforms enhance operational efficiency by allowing workers to perform maintenance, inventory management, and equipment servicing at elevated heights. The growing trend towards automation in industrial operations is also contributing to the demand for advanced aerial equipment, as companies look to improve safety and reduce downtime. As industries increasingly prioritize worker safety and efficiency, the market for aerial platform vehicles tailored for industrial applications is expected to flourish.
Commercial:
In the commercial sector, aerial platform vehicles are utilized extensively for maintenance and installation tasks. Businesses in retail, hospitality, and facility management rely on these vehicles to ensure their structures remain in optimal condition. Aerial platforms are essential for tasks such as signage installation, lighting maintenance, and facade repairs. The rising trend of facility upgrades and renovations, particularly in urban areas, continues to bolster the demand for aerial platforms in commercial applications. Moreover, the increasing focus on safety and compliance in commercial environments is encouraging companies to invest in modern aerial platform vehicles.
Residential:
The residential application of aerial platform vehicles is gaining momentum, particularly as more homeowners and contractors seek efficient solutions for maintenance and renovation projects. Aerial platforms provide safe access for tasks such as roof repairs, painting, and tree trimming in residential settings. As the trend towards DIY home improvement projects grows, the market for aerial platform vehicles catering to residential applications is expected to expand. Additionally, rental services for aerial lifts are becoming more popular among homeowners looking to complete specific tasks without a significant upfront investment in equipment.
Others:
Other applications for aerial platform vehicles include sectors such as film production, agriculture, and telecommunications. In the film industry, aerial lifts are used for capturing elevated shots and managing lighting setups. In agriculture, they provide access for maintenance of high-tech equipment and installations. Telecommunications companies utilize aerial platforms to install and maintain cell towers, ensuring connectivity across urban and rural areas. As diverse industries recognize the value of aerial platform vehicles for specific tasks, this segment is expected to contribute to overall market growth.

By Fuel Type
Electric:
Electric aerial platform vehicles are gaining popularity due to their environmentally friendly characteristics and cost-effectiveness. They produce zero emissions during operation, making them suitable for indoor and urban environments where air quality is a concern. Electric models often come with advanced battery technologies that allow for extended operational times and reduced charging periods, enhancing their usability. As companies become more environmentally conscious and comply with stricter regulations, the electric aerial platform segment is poised for significant growth in the coming years.
Diesel:
Diesel-powered aerial platform vehicles are favored for their robust performance and ability to operate in rugged outdoor environments. These vehicles deliver higher lifting capacities and longer operational ranges compared to electric models, making them ideal for heavy-duty construction projects and industrial applications. The durability and power of diesel aerial platforms allow them to perform effectively in challenging conditions. However, with increasing environmental regulations, the market is seeing a gradual shift towards more sustainable fuel options, although diesel platforms will continue to play a significant role in large-scale projects.
Hybrid:
Hybrid aerial platform vehicles combine the advantages of both electric and diesel technologies, allowing operators to switch between power sources based on their needs. This versatility makes hybrid models suitable for a wide range of applications, from indoor tasks where electric power is preferred to outdoor operations requiring the strength of diesel power. The hybrid option is particularly appealing to companies aiming to reduce their carbon footprint while maintaining high performance. As the market increasingly prioritizes sustainability, hybrid aerial platforms are likely to see a rise in adoption, bridging the gap between conventional and eco-friendly solutions.

Threats
Despite the promising growth prospects, the aerial platform vehicles market faces various threats that could hinder its overall development. One of the primary concerns is the increasing competition from alternative lifting solutions, such as telehandlers and forklifts, which may offer similar capabilities at a lower cost. As more companies explore various options for height access and material handling, aerial platforms may struggle to maintain their market share. Moreover, fluctuating raw material prices and supply chain disruptions can impact manufacturing costs, leading to potential price increases that could deter customers. Lastly, economic uncertainties and potential recessionary pressures in key markets could adversely affect construction activity, subsequently impacting the demand for aerial platform vehicles.
Another significant threat to the aerial platform vehicles market is the evolving regulatory landscape regarding emissions and safety standards. Manufacturers must continuously adapt to meet stringent regulations, particularly as governments worldwide emphasize sustainability and environmental responsibility. The transition towards electric and hybrid vehicles is essential to comply with these new standards; however, the associated research and development costs may be a barrier for smaller manufacturers. Additionally, if companies fail to prioritize safety in their designs, they risk potential liability issues and reputational damage, which could further jeopardize their market position.
